Hita vs Davis Climate & Distance Between

Antarctica flag
  • The distance between Hita, Japan and Davis, Antarctica is approximately 12,133 km or 7,540 mi.
  • To reach Hita in this distance one would set out from Davis bearing 44.9°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Hita bearing 18° or NNE .
  • Hita has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Davis has a tundra climate (ET).
  • The annual average temperature is 25 °C (45.1°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 4.5 °C (8.1°F) more in Hita.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to semicont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1722.5 mm (67.8 in) more which is equivalent to 1722.5 l/m² (42.27 US gal/ft²) or 17,225,000 l/ha (1,841,467 US gal/ac) more. About 25 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 35.8° higher in Hita than in Davis.
